Fixes SNUBA-9Y5. The issue was that: DatadogMetricsBackend's thread-local property corrupted during librdkafka callback exception, causing SystemError when logging metrics.
self.__metrics.incrementin the__record_commit_statusmethod withtry...exceptblocks.This fix was generated by Seer in Sentry, triggered by pierre.massat@sentry.io. 👁️ Run ID: 10536178
